Programación y Desarrollo para Android Subforo exclusivo para temas de programación de software para PDAs y desarrollo de aplicaciones, interfaces, etc bajo Android


 
Herramientas
  #1  
Viejo 25/06/13, 18:04:50
Avatar de Bongiovi
Bongiovi Bongiovi no está en línea
Miembro del foro
Mensajes: 186
 
Fecha de registro: oct 2012
Localización: España
Mensajes: 186
Modelo de smartphone: Motorola Moto G , BQ Maxwell 2 Lite
Tu operador: Simyo
Mencionado: 0 comentarios
Tagged: 0 hilos
Aprender un poco de Java en casa.

Buenas, tengo la intención de introducirme en el desarrollo de apps en Android. La intención es trabajar en casa este verano y en febrero apuntarme a un curso que se imparte en mi Universidad.

De momento he encontrado esto:

http://www.sgoliver.net/blog/?page_id=3011

Lo cual tiene una pinta fantástica, pero me gustaría empezar por toquetear un poco en Java. ¿Sabéis de algún tutorial/manual específico de Java para android? No quiero perderme en programación muy avanzada, solo manejar lo básico de Java y a la vez aprender el entorno de Android.

Decir que soy estudiante de Ingeniería Industrial, tengo conocimientos básicos de C (una asignatura en la carrera).

Un saludo y gracias!
Responder Con Cita


  #2  
Viejo 25/06/13, 18:49:41
Avatar de mocelet
mocelet mocelet no está en línea
Desarrollador
Mensajes: 2,203
 
Fecha de registro: may 2011
Localización: Madrid
Mensajes: 2,203
Tu operador: -
Mencionado: 17 comentarios
Tagged: 2 hilos
Hace unos días se comentó algo del estilo: http://www.htcmania.com/showthread.php?t=632283
Responder Con Cita
  #3  
Viejo 25/06/13, 18:56:11
Avatar de Bongiovi
Bongiovi Bongiovi no está en línea
Miembro del foro
Mensajes: 186
 
Fecha de registro: oct 2012
Localización: España
Mensajes: 186
Modelo de smartphone: Motorola Moto G , BQ Maxwell 2 Lite
Tu operador: Simyo
Mencionado: 0 comentarios
Tagged: 0 hilos
Cita:
Originalmente Escrito por mocelet Ver Mensaje
Hace unos días se comentó algo del estilo: http://www.htcmania.com/showthread.php?t=632283
Gracias por responder ;)

Me he bajado el archivo que subió el compañero "kleiser", ahi tnego material de sobra para empezar con Java.
Ya digo que no me gustaría "perder el tiempo" profundizando mucho en Java. Prefiero saber lo básico para empezar a desarrollar apps sencillas (siempre apps, nada de juegos). De todas maneras parece que el archivo que menciono más arriba es una introducción muy básica a Java.

Un saludo!

EDITO

Acabo de darme cuenta de que el pdf que subió "kleiser" fué redactado en el año 2000
Tal vez sería más recomendable utilizar cursos o tutoriales algo más recientes, no?

Última edición por Bongiovi Día 25/06/13 a las 19:11:34
Responder Con Cita
  #4  
Viejo 25/06/13, 19:24:05
Avatar de mocelet
mocelet mocelet no está en línea
Desarrollador
Mensajes: 2,203
 
Fecha de registro: may 2011
Localización: Madrid
Mensajes: 2,203
Tu operador: -
Mencionado: 17 comentarios
Tagged: 2 hilos
Será el mítico Aprenda Java como si estuviera en primero, ¿no?. Es un gran tutorial para los conceptos, te lo iba a recomendar. Los conceptos siguen siendo los mismos, lo que pasa es que hay alguna cosilla que es más elegante hacerla de otra forma actualmente en Java (tipos genéricos, for each, enums y poco más, que antes de Java 5 no existían).

Los conceptos que tienes que tener claros son los que indicaba en mis mensajes de ese hilo, las estructuras de control ya te las sabes de C, eso que te ahorras. También te debería ser más fácil de comprender el concepto de objeto, referencia, etc.
Responder Con Cita
  #5  
Viejo 25/06/13, 19:47:10
Avatar de Bongiovi
Bongiovi Bongiovi no está en línea
Miembro del foro
Mensajes: 186
 
Fecha de registro: oct 2012
Localización: España
Mensajes: 186
Modelo de smartphone: Motorola Moto G , BQ Maxwell 2 Lite
Tu operador: Simyo
Mencionado: 0 comentarios
Tagged: 0 hilos
Cita:
Originalmente Escrito por mocelet Ver Mensaje
Será el mítico Aprenda Java como si estuviera en primero, ¿no?. Es un gran tutorial para los conceptos, te lo iba a recomendar. Los conceptos siguen siendo los mismos, lo que pasa es que hay alguna cosilla que es más elegante hacerla de otra forma actualmente en Java (tipos genéricos, for each, enums y poco más, que antes de Java 5 no existían).

Los conceptos que tienes que tener claros son los que indicaba en mis mensajes de ese hilo, las estructuras de control ya te las sabes de C, eso que te ahorras. También te debería ser más fácil de comprender el concepto de objeto, referencia, etc.
Ese mismo es! Intentaré leerlo mientras sigo el curso que puse al principio del post.

Gracias por la ayuda, seguiré comentando por aquí cuando avance algo más ;)

Un saludo.
Responder Con Cita
  #6  
Viejo 25/06/13, 23:04:13
Avatar de mocelet
mocelet mocelet no está en línea
Desarrollador
Mensajes: 2,203
 
Fecha de registro: may 2011
Localización: Madrid
Mensajes: 2,203
Tu operador: -
Mencionado: 17 comentarios
Tagged: 2 hilos
Lo he vuelto a abrir para echarle un vistazo, el capítulo 7 (Applets) y el 10 (otras herramientas de Java) te los puedes saltar alegremente porque no te valen para nada.

El capítulo 5 es de interfaces gráficas en Java de escritorio, podrías saltártelo porque cualquier tutorial de Android ya te va a explicar cómo hacer la interfaz y cambian algunas cosas -más de forma que de fondo-.

El resto de capítulos son temas imprescindibles para facilitar el entendimiento del API de Android.

Última edición por mocelet Día 25/06/13 a las 23:07:57
Responder Con Cita
  #7  
Viejo 26/06/13, 08:35:38
Avatar de set92
set92 set92 no está en línea
Miembro del foro
Mensajes: 468
 
Fecha de registro: jun 2012
Mensajes: 468
Modelo de smartphone: samsung
Tu operador: Movistar
Mencionado: 0 comentarios
Tagged: 0 hilos
Si quieres curso tienes este que es de introduccion a la programacion en java, igual es algo lento puesto que igual ya sabes las bases de programacion pero otra opcion https://www.udacity.com/course/cs046
Responder Con Cita
  #8  
Viejo 26/06/13, 16:03:35
Avatar de kleiser
kleiser kleiser no está en línea
Miembro del foro
Mensajes: 124
 
Fecha de registro: mar 2013
Localización: cadiz/madrid
Mensajes: 124
Tu operador: Vodafone
Mencionado: 0 comentarios
Tagged: 0 hilos
Como dice mocelet suprime esos temas! No te quedes solo con ese archivo, como ya se dijo en el otro post tienes tambien los videos de outkast por si te resulta mas facil ver en video lo que no entiendas!!
Responder Con Cita
  #9  
Viejo 27/06/13, 04:51:58
Avatar de christian_rios
christian_rios christian_rios no está en línea
Miembro del foro
Mensajes: 95
 
Fecha de registro: abr 2012
Localización: mexico
Mensajes: 95
Modelo de smartphone: Moto G
Versión de ROM: stock
Tu operador: Movistar
Mencionado: 0 comentarios
Tagged: 0 hilos
Puedes ver los vídeo tutoriales de outkast este es el primer vídeo del curso


También te dejo este libro

https://docs.google.com/file/d/0BwxT...p=docslist_api

Si ya tienes conocimientos en c lo mas probable es que no se te dificulte mucho java
Responder Con Cita
  #10  
Viejo 27/06/13, 09:28:35
Avatar de mocelet
mocelet mocelet no está en línea
Desarrollador
Mensajes: 2,203
 
Fecha de registro: may 2011
Localización: Madrid
Mensajes: 2,203
Tu operador: -
Mencionado: 17 comentarios
Tagged: 2 hilos
Es la primera vez que veo una trolltuga

Tan malo no debe ser cuando está presente en sistemas financieros y de comercio electrónico, reproductores de bluray, tarjetas inteligentes, PCs, servicios de red, móviles por supuesto...

Si el JDownloader estuviera hecho en C tal vez no podrías usarlo en windows, o en mac, o en linux, o en tu sistema operativo favorito. Estaría para una plataforma solo y da gracias.
Responder Con Cita
  #11  
Viejo 27/06/13, 15:24:00
Avatar de Bongiovi
Bongiovi Bongiovi no está en línea
Miembro del foro
Mensajes: 186
 
Fecha de registro: oct 2012
Localización: España
Mensajes: 186
Modelo de smartphone: Motorola Moto G , BQ Maxwell 2 Lite
Tu operador: Simyo
Mencionado: 0 comentarios
Tagged: 0 hilos
Gracias a todos por la ayuda. Estoy siguiendo el curso que puse al principio del post, pero complementare con los videos y la documentacion que me habeis facilitado.

Un saludo!
Responder Con Cita
Respuesta

Estás aquí
Regresar   HTCMania > Todo sobre Android > Programación y Desarrollo para Android

Herramientas

Reglas de Mensajes
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Las caritas están On
Código [IMG] está On
Código HTML está Off

Saltar a Foro



Hora actual: 17:43:36 (GMT +1)

Cookies settings
Powered by vBulletin™
Copyright © vBulletin Solutions, Inc. All rights reserved.
 
HTCMania: líderes desde el 2007